Notes about Hertog Frederik Ii "Ferry" van Lotharingen

Heer van Amance 1198, hertog van Lotharingen en markgraaf 1206, vermeld 1189. Ondersteunt Otto IV van Braunschweig bij de troonopvolging, trekt met hem 1209/11 naar Italië.
